A gold label on a Hudson Bay 4-point blanket indicates a vintage blanket, specifically from a period around the 1930s to 1940s where Hudson's Bay Company used gold labels on their blankets.

 

As the trappers would sell and exchange these blankets, the thin black lines running along the side became a shorthand so that during the sale they could size the blankets without having to unfurl them.  The point system was invented by French weavers in the mid 18th century as a means of indicating the size of a blanket. This shifted from time to time. Today, Hbc blankets are available in point sizes: 3.5 (twin), 4 (double), 6 (queen), and 8 (king).
